Output 36657dd77b3aec9012ecfca9957cb0a77ff596fc643c2f01569f40655d5ebaea:7

value
321348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2c445099870b83d3ec433d0770191503a706a16 OP_EQUAL
address
3LuSwtFSZtd91ZnYxtXvxHYWCucwzAPAq2
transaction
36657dd77b3aec9012ecfca9957cb0a77ff596fc643c2f01569f40655d5ebaea
confirmations
330472
spent
true